With its wisteria-covered courtyard, acres of olive and almond trees, exquisite pool and authentic interiors, the allure of this 700-year old weathered stone villa is hard to beat. Inside, the place blends antique furnishings with stylish modern features, creating an inviting space to relax between sunbathing sessions in the garden and day trips to nearby villages. Put your feet up and flick through the coffee table books in the white-washed living room before heading into the garden to handpick ingredients for lunch. Embrace your inner pizzaiolo and top homemade pizzas with fresh figs and generous drizzles of honey. Once replete, find a lounger in the shade for a well-earned cat nap. If you’re keen to explore, check out the on-site, underground limestone cave with 7th-century frescoes or take a bicycle tour through the countryside. Stop for a bite to eat in the foodie haven of Ceglie Messapica – it’s only ten minutes away. For those who like to unwind on the beach, Puglia’s stunning coastline is less than a thirty-minute drive from your doorstep.

About Ostuni

You’ll probably spot Ostuni long before you reach the so-called White City of Puglia. It rises up on three hills, above the rust-red earth punctuated by olive trees. Shambling, narrow streets lead up the hillside to the crowning 12th-century Ostuni Cathedral.
